About the event

Domestic abuse encompasses intimate partner violence; coercive and financial control; and psychological abuse. Understanding the signs of all forms of domestic abuse is key to prevention and early intervention. With recent legislative updates including the Child Support Collection Act; Victims and Prisoners Bill; and new statutory guidance; join our timely Tackling Domestic Abuse Conference in March to hear updates from experts; policy makers and specialist practitioners. With £257 million of new funding allocated to local authorities; we will explore how agencies can work together to ensure safety for all survivors; prevent offending and break the cycle of abuse.
